What lounge seating works in a real estate sales office or model unit?
Real estate offices need lounge seating that feels aspirational — it should make buyers feel excited about what they're considering purchasing. Current, on-trend designs in quality-looking upholstery (warm leathers, textured fabrics, brass or matte black accents on legs) signal that the company is tuned in to lifestyle and design. Model units benefit from residential-aesthetic but contract-grade lounge pieces that photograph well. Sales office waiting areas should feel premium without being intimidating. Neutral palettes with one accent color keep things broadly appealing.
